Dr. M. Michele Blackwood is the Medical Director of the Center for Breast Health and Disease Management at the Barnabas Health Ambulatory Care Center and Director of Breast Surgery for RWJBarnabas Health. She leads a system-wide team of breast surgeons and provides expert care in the management of complex breast malignancies. She has extensive experience in breast cancer surgery, including advanced techniques for high-risk patients and men with breast cancer.
